Three people were shot at Pittsburgh Brashear High School in Beechview this afternoon, an Allegheny County dispatch supervisor said. Police and K-9 units are searching the nearby woods for the shooter, the dispatcher supervisor said. Police said three men dressed in black were reported shooting toward the school from a hill above. All three people were shot outside, police said. A bullet grazed one person. The conditions of the other two people shot was not known, police said. An Allegheny General Hospital spokesman confirmed one male high school student was a patient and that his condition was considered stable. Several streets nearby have been closed, including Crane Avenue at Fallowfield Avenue and Dagmar Avenue.
